主题
一线技术人述职,高手从不讲“我写了多少代码”
年底了,每个一线开发都在准备述职。我们一年忙到头,接了无数需求,修了无数 Bug,工作大多琐碎、重复、具体。
如何让自己的述职不是泯然众人,能在 Leader 面前脱颖而出?关键是让领导听了能记住,这前提就是你说的,要能触动 Leader 的“关注点”。
一线技术人述职最大的坑,就是把技术报告当成述职报告,大谈特谈用了什么框架、写了多少行代码,结果领导听了只觉得“这人挺忙,但不知道对业务有啥用”。
真正的述职,是用技术的语言,讲业务的故事。核心就三句话:
- 别只讲“我做了什么功能”,先讲“业务痛点解决了没”
- 别只堆“苦劳指标”,要证明“体验因此变好了”
- 别只报“任务上线”,要交出“能复用的资产”
下面我们把这三点拆开,换成一线开发听得懂、用得上的动作。
第一招:把你的代码,焊死在领导的“心头痛”上
述职不是技术分享,开口的第一句话,就决定了领导把你当成“干活的”还是“能扛事的”。
- 普通开发开头:“本年度,我主要负责了 XX 管理后台的开发,使用了 Vue+SpringBoot,完成了用户、权限等模块的迭代……”
- 高手开头:“今年 Leader 最关注的点是 ‘运营效率’ 和 ‘系统稳定性’ 。围绕这个目标,我的工作主要聚焦于解决运营配置繁琐和修复历史遗留 Bug两件事,让运营配置时间缩短了一半,系统核心链路更稳定了。”
具体怎么做? 落笔前,别打开 Git 记录,先回忆三件事:
- 领导最近骂过什么? (是系统太卡?是 Bug 太多?还是运营老提需求?)
- 业务方最近抱怨什么? (是报表跑不出?是导出太慢?还是操作太复杂?)
- 团队最头疼的是什么? (是没人敢接的烂代码?还是每次上线都出事?)
然后,像做数据关联一样,把你的“搬砖”记录和这些痛点强行连线。你的每一部分工作,都必须能说清是为了支撑解决上述哪个问题。这能让领导立刻意识到:你懂业务,你的代码是有靶向性的。
第二招:忘掉技术指标,翻译成“人话”结果
你加班加点优化的每一个技术细节,在领导听来可能是“杂音”。你的任务是把它们“翻译”成业务和体验语言。
| 别再主要汇报这些 (技术过程的“辛苦指标”) | 要重点汇报这些 (业务结果的“硬核变化”) |
|---|---|
| “我重构了 500 行代码” | “这个功能以前要改 3 个文件,现在封装好了,以后同类需求开发只需改 1 个地方,维护更简单了。” |
| “我加了 10 条校验逻辑” | “通过完善防错机制,把运营经常配错数据导致的客诉彻底归零了。” |
| “我修复了 50 个 Bug” | “集中治理了 XX 模块的历史遗留问题,这块“雷区”现在基本排干净了,上线更安心了。” |
| “我写了复杂 SQL 做统计” | “优化了数据查询逻辑,以前报表要等 5 分钟,现在点开秒出,运营同学不用天天盯着屏幕叹气了。” |
核心心法:在你的述职报告里,为每一个技术动作,都强行加上一个 “因此,所以……”(So What?) 的结论。这能逼你从“写代码思维”跳到“交付价值思维”。
第三招:从“项目完工”到“资产沉淀”
普通员工汇报“干完了一个需求”。高手汇报“为团队留下了一套以后都能用的工具”。
这才是让领导觉得你“有沉淀”的关键。你不仅解决了今天的问题,还投资了团队的明天。
- 不要只说:“我完成了数据导出功能。”
- 一定要说:“在做导出功能之外,我还沉淀了一样东西:封装了一个通用的 Excel 导出工具类,现在其他开发遇到类似导出需求,直接调这个就行,不用再从头写一堆 POI 代码。这为团队后续开发节省了不少重复劳动。”
作为一线开发,你可以从这些低门槛、高价值的维度去“创造资产”:
- 文档类:一份清晰的新人上手文档、一份复杂的业务逻辑说明图、一张常见报错处理速查表。
- 代码类:一个被大家公认为好用的公共函数、一个清理了“屎山”后的核心类。
- 知识类:一次关于“如何避免空指针”的代码分享、一个典型线上事故的复盘报告。
一个一线技术述职的“作弊”结构
基于以上三点,你可以按这个结构组织内容(直接填空):
标题:[姓名] - [年份] 年度述职:以技术支撑[核心业务目标]
第一部分:对齐与锚定(1 页 PPT)
- “今年,我紧密围绕部门‘提升系统稳定性’的核心目标,将个人工作聚焦于治理历史遗留 Bug与优化核心链路体验两大战场。”
第二部分:战果与翻译(2-3 页 PPT)
- 战役一:攻克 XX 运营配置痛点,提升业务效率
- 背景:运营反馈配置一个活动要填 10 个表单,极其繁琐且易错。
- 我的动作:开发了模板化导入功能,增加了前置校验。
- 核心翻译:将运营配置时间从 30 分钟缩短到 5 分钟,彻底解决了因配置错误导致的线上事故问题。
- 战役二:治理 XX 模块“重灾区”,提升系统信心
- 背景:XX 模块代码陈旧,经常出 Bug,没人敢动。
- 我的动作:主动认领重构,补充了单元测试,理清了逻辑。
- 核心翻译:该模块 Q3 季度零线上故障,释放了团队维护精力,让我们能更专注新业务。
第三部分:沉淀与展望(1 页 PPT)
- 留下的资产:“除了完成业务需求,本年度我最重要的输出是:1)《XX 业务复杂逻辑说明书》(被组内新人称为‘救命文档’);2)通用的数据脱敏工具类;3)一次关于‘优雅处理异常’的内部分享。”
- 明年规划:“明年,我计划继续深挖业务细节,目标是成为 XX 业务域的‘技术兜底人’,并尝试引入自动化测试脚本,进一步降低回归测试的成本。”
总结:一线技术人的价值,不在于你写了多么炫酷的架构,而在于你把那些琐碎、难搞的“坑”给填平了,并且修了一条好走的路给后面的人。 述职时,请用领导的思维框架,包装你的技术成果。
有我,这一年确实不一样。
PPT 大纲模板一(传统)
bash
由于人若彩虹,遇上方知有。好的述职PPT也是如此,不需要花哨的动画,而是**逻辑的视觉化**。
既然我们明确了“不谈苦劳,谈资产”和“对齐业务”的策略,下面这套PPT模板就是专门为**一线技术人**设计的。你可以直接把这套逻辑复制到PPT里,填上你的内容即可。
---
### **PPT 结构大纲(共 8-10 页)**
1. **封面页**:一句话定义你的价值
2. **对齐页**:我懂团队目标,我不是盲目干活
3. **核心业绩一(业务支撑)**:解决了痛点,提升了体验
4. **核心业绩二(技术治理/提效)**:填了坑,省了心
5. **资产沉淀页**:我留下了什么(团队资产)
6. **不足与复盘**:真诚且有建设性
7. **未来规划**:继续做团队的“稳定器”
8. **结束页**:致谢
---
### **PPT 逐页内容详解(可直接复制)**
#### **P1 封面页**
* **主标题**:**202X年度述职报告**
* **副标题**:**聚焦业务痛点,沉淀技术资产,打造稳定高效的系统体验**
* **汇报人**:[你的名字]
* **岗位**:后端开发工程师 / Java开发工程师
* **日期**:202X年X月
---
#### **P2 年度概览:对齐目标,聚焦价值**
* **设计思路**:左边写团队目标,右边写你的工作方向,中间用箭头连接,展示“懂大局”。
* **[页面上半部分] 核心关键词**
* 系统稳定性 (Stability)
* 研发效能 (Efficiency)
* 业务支撑 (Support)
* **[页面下半部分] 年度工作数据罗列(用大数字展示)**
* **需求交付率**:100%(按时交付核心需求 **X** 个)
* **线上故障**:**0** 起(核心负责模块)
* **资产沉淀**:**X** 份(文档/工具/组件)
* **Bug修复**:**X** 个(含历史遗留顽固Bug)
---
#### **P3 核心业绩一:业务支撑(Solve Pain Points)**
* **标题**:**攻坚业务痛点,提升运营/用户效率**
* **[左栏] 背景:业务方最头疼什么?**
* *痛点描述*:原XX报表导出速度慢,运营每月底需耗时1小时等待且经常超时。
* *影响*:严重影响了月底结算效率,引发业务方投诉。
* **[中栏] 动作:我做了什么关键动作?**
* **技术手段**:重构查询SQL,引入多线程异步处理,优化Excel生成逻辑。
* **关键决策**:将全量内存加载改为流式写入,降低服务器内存压力。
* **[右栏] 结果:带来了什么变化?(重点!)**
* **效率提升**:导出时间从 **60分钟** 缩短至 **2分钟**。
* **业务价值**:运营月底结算工作提前半天完成,彻底解决超时投诉。
---
#### **P4 核心业绩二:技术治理(Clean the Mess)**
* **标题**:**治理历史“雷区”,筑牢系统防线**
* **[左栏] 背景:系统最脆弱的地方在哪里?**
* *痛点描述*:XX订单模块代码逻辑混乱,历史Bug多,改动一处崩多处,团队“不敢动”。
* **[中栏] 动作:我不仅修了Bug,还做了什么?**
* **重构优化**:梳理核心链路逻辑,剥离冗余代码,补全核心流程的单元测试。
* **防守机制**:增加了XX个关键节点的数据校验和异常熔断。
* **[右栏] 结果:系统变好了吗?**
* **稳定性**:该模块Q3/Q4季度 **0 线上事故**。
* **维护性**:新需求开发逻辑清晰,Code Review 一次通过率提升 **50%**。
---
#### **P5 资产沉淀:我不止是写代码**
* **标题**:**沉淀团队资产,拒绝重复造轮子**
* **设计思路**:用图标+短句的形式,展示你留下的“遗产”。
* **[内容]**
1. **《XX业务复杂逻辑说明书》**
* *价值*:新人上手时间从3天缩短到0.5天,减少老同事沟通成本。
2. **通用工具类**
* *价值*:封装了[日期处理/加解密/日志脱敏]组件,被组内3个项目引用。
3. **技术分享**
* *内容*:《如何优雅地处理空指针异常》组内分享。
* *价值*:统一了组内异常处理规范,减少了NPE类低级Bug。
---
#### **P6 不足与复盘**
* **标题**:**直面短板,持续精进**
* **[不足点1] 对上游业务的理解深度有待加强**
* *体现*:前期开发中,曾因对业务规则理解偏差导致返工一次。
* *改进措施*:建立“开发前五问”机制,在需求评审时主动追问业务背景。
* **[不足点2] 自动化测试覆盖率不足**
* *体现*:目前主要依靠人工回归测试,效率较低。
* *改进措施*:计划明年学习并引入单元测试框架,逐步提高核心模块覆盖。
---
#### **P7 未来规划**
* **标题**:**202X年规划:做更靠谱的技术人**
* **[方向一] 深化业务域认知**
* 成为XX业务域的“技术兜底人”,不仅是写代码,更要能从技术角度提出业务优化建议。
* **[方向二] 提升工程效能**
* 推进[XX模块]的接口自动化测试落地,目标是将回归测试时间缩短30%。
* **[方向三] 技术广度拓展**
* 深入学习[消息队列/分布式事务]原理,并尝试在XX场景中落地应用。
---
#### **P8 结束页**
* **中央大字**:**感谢聆听,请指正**
* **下方小字**:*技术不仅是代码,更是解决问题的能力。*
* **Contact**:[你的名字/邮箱/部门]
---
### **给PPT制作的小建议(视觉加分项)**
1. **少字多图**:
* 不要把你的代码逻辑直接截图贴上去(字体太小看不清,也没人想看)。
* **画图!** 用简单的流程图、时序图,或者“Before vs After”的对比图来展示你的优化效果。
2. **数据高亮**:
* 所有的关键数字(如 **300%**, **0**, **2分钟**),请用**醒目的颜色**(如橙色、红色)标粗放大。这是领导目光的落脚点。
3. **排版对齐**:
* 保持页面元素对齐,看起来专业、清爽。这本身就是代码洁癖的一种延伸表现。PPT 大纲模板二(AI)
bash
### PPT 结构大纲
1. **封面页**:一句话定义你的价值
2. **对齐页**:我懂团队目标,我善用工具提效
3. **核心业绩一(业务支撑)**:利用AI快速攻坚,解决痛点
4. **核心业绩二(技术治理)**:AI辅助重构/测试,提升质量
5. **资产沉淀页(重点更新)**:沉淀AI使用方法论,赋能团队
6. **不足与复盘**:真诚且有建设性
7. **未来规划(重点更新)**:构建AI辅助开发工作流
8. **结束页**:致谢
---
### **PPT 逐页更新详解**
#### **P1 封面页**
* **主标题**:**202X年度述职报告**
* **副标题**:**拥抱AI技术,聚焦业务痛点,打造高效智能的研发体验**
* *(微调:在副标题中加入“AI”元素,定调)*
---
#### **P2 年度概览:数据说话(含AI提效指标)**
* **设计思路**:在关键数据中加入AI带来的效率提升。
* **[页面下半部分] 年度工作数据罗列**
* **需求交付率**:100%(按时交付核心需求 **X** 个)
* **研发效能提升**:**+30%**(通过引入AI辅助编码,减少重复性劳动)
* **线上故障**:**0** 起(核心负责模块)
* **资产沉淀**:**X** 份(含 **AI Prompt 模板库**)
---
#### **P3 核心业绩一:业务支撑(AI作为攻坚加速器)**
* **标题**:**善用AI攻坚复杂逻辑,缩短交付周期**
* **[左栏] 背景:业务方最头疼什么?**
* *痛点描述*:新需求涉及复杂的XX算法规则,且接口文档多达50+页,人工阅读梳理耗时极长。
* **[中栏] 动作:我如何利用AI破局?**
* **信息提炼**:利用AI工具快速解析长文档,自动生成字段映射关系,将理解时间从2天缩短至2小时。
* **代码生成**:使用AI生成基础CRUD代码和复杂正则校验,我专注于核心业务逻辑的编排与安全审核。
* **[右栏] 结果:带来了什么变化?**
* **效率飞跃**:项目开发周期原定2周,实际 **1周** 完成交付。
* **质量保证**:利用AI辅助生成的代码,经过Code Review和我的严格把关,**上线无Bug**。
---
#### **P4 核心业绩二:技术治理(AI作为质量守门员)**
* **标题**:**AI辅助重构与测试,筑牢系统防线**
* **[左栏] 背景:系统脆弱,测试难**
* *痛点描述*:XX模块历史代码缺少单元测试,回归测试全靠人工,覆盖面低,风险大。
* **[中栏] 动作:AI+人工双重保障**
* **测试覆盖**:利用AI工具为核心模块自动生成了 **80+** 个单元测试用例,覆盖了主要分支逻辑。
* **代码优化**:使用AI工具扫描代码异味,并辅助进行复杂SQL的改写优化。
* **[右栏] 结果:系统变好了吗?**
* **回归效率**:单元测试执行时间仅需30秒,替代了人工1小时的测试工作。
* **信心提升**:该模块Q3/Q4季度 **0 线上事故**,重构风险完全可控。
---
#### **P5 资产沉淀:从“会用AI”到“教会团队用AI”(重磅页面)**
* **标题**:**沉淀AI开发范式,赋能团队提效**
* **设计思路**:这是最加分的地方。证明你不是一个人在用,而是把经验变成了团队资产。
* **[内容]**
1. **《团队专用 AI Prompt 模板库》**
* *内容*:总结了代码生成、SQL优化、Bug定位、技术文档编写等 **4大类 20+** 条高频优质指令。
* *价值*:组员复制即用,大幅降低了使用AI的试错成本,团队整体编码效率提升约20%。
2. **《AI辅助代码审查规范》**
* *内容*:制定了一套“AI预审+人工复核”的CR流程。
* *价值*:拦截了60%的低级语法错误和潜在空指针风险,释放了资深开发的时间。
3. **技术分享**:《如何像高级工程师一样写Prompt》
* *价值*:帮助团队成员正确使用AI工具,避免过度依赖。
---
#### **P7 未来规划:深化AI驱动的研发模式**
* **标题**:**202X年规划:构建AI Native研发工作流**
* **[方向一] 深化业务域认知**
* 结合AI大模型能力,尝试搭建内部知识库问答机器人,降低新人查阅文档成本。
* **[方向二] 全面拥抱AI测试**
* 探索利用AI生成端到端(E2E)的自动化测试脚本,目标是将核心业务回归测试覆盖率提升至90%。
* **[方向三] 智能运维探索**
* 尝试利用AI分析线上日志,实现异常根因的自动定位,缩短故障排查时间(MTTR)。